FOUNDATION, HEIGHT & SETUP REQUIREMENTS

Piles

450 mm Ground Clearance

Homes are designed to be installed with 450 mm (45 cm) clearance off the ground.
This height supports:

  • airflow underneath
     
  • access for plumbing and drainage
     
  • space to add underfloor insulation if you choose
     
  • general maintenance
     

Underfloor insulation is not included with the build.
Insulation can be added underneath after the home is positioned on your foundation.

Foundation Layout

Homes are installed on a raised pile system, deck platform, or steel sub-frame that provides the 450 mm clearance.

Please use the foundation diagram below for correct pile positioning and spacing.
This layout can be given directly to your builder or installer.


Sealing After Delivery

Once the home is opened on-site, the following areas can be checked and sealed:

  • roof joins and flashings
     
  • fold-out seams
     
  • window and door trims
     
  • exterior panel joins
     

Sealant is supplied with your build for these areas.

Corrosion Protection

In coastal, high-salt, or exposed locations, the following care is recommended:

  • apply marine-grade rust protection spray to exposed metal
     
  • touch up minor marks with anti-corrosive metal paint

20ft,30ft,40ft Foundation Layouts

20ft Foundation Layout

20ft Foundation Layout

20ft Foundation Layout

Overall footprint approx. 5900mm (L) × 5000mm (W).
Pink squares show recommended pile/support points.
Main grid spacing: 2160mm – 2220mm – 2160mm across, with edge cover both sides.
Use this layout for all 20ft expandable homes.
